Superior Environmental Services
Open
755 W James Lee Blvd
Crestview, FL 32536
Superior Environmental Services, based in Crestview, has established itself as a premier Environmental Solutions Company with a 30-year track record.
Specializing in Environmental and Ecological Services, Superior operates across the United States, delivering top-notch solutions to a wide range of clients.
Generated from their website's infomation
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.